Abstract

This community service activity was carried out in collaboration with lecturers from STIE YAI, students, and teaching staff at LBBP (Lembaga Bimbingan Belajar Pelajar) D’King Study in Kramat Jati, East Jakarta. The implementation methods included lectures, discussions, Q&A sessions, and training on the use of digital technology in learning activities as an effort to transform education and realize "Merdeka Belajar" (Freedom to Learn). The use of technology is expected to enhance the quality of learning. There are three outcomes from the discussion held during the digital education outreach activities. First, a Unified Understanding of Educational Digitalization: The participants, especially the educators at LBBP D’King Study, gained a shared understanding of strengthening educational digitalization. They are now capable of creating learning materials with the help of digital technology, making the content more engaging, communicative, and easier for students to comprehend. This, in turn, boosts the students' motivation to learn. Second, the Successful Execution of Activities: The community service activities focused on strengthening educational digitalization were well-executed and aligned with the planned objectives. Third, Follow-Up Phases Planned: After the completion of this community service, subsequent steps will be taken to maintain consistency in contributing to the advancement of educational digitalization at LBBP D’King Study in Kramat Jati, East Jakarta. These efforts are part of an ongoing commitment to improve the quality of education through technology integration.
